The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of George Beynon, born in 1857 in Glamorganshire, consisted of 7 members. George was the head of the household, married to Mary Beynon, born in 1855 in Glamorganshire, Wales. They had 3 children; Margaret (born 1876 in Glamorganshire, Wales), Mary (born 1878 in Glamorganshire, Wales) and Ann (born 1880 in Glamorganshire, Wales).
During the period, also present in the household were George's Servant, Elizabeth (born 1861 in Glamorganshire, Wales) and George's Servant, Thomas (born 1866 in Llangennith, Glamorganshire, Wales).
